Overview of the CR-56 AMAX
The CR-56 AMAX is a lightweight, full-auto assault rifle chambered in 7.62 x 39mm ammunition. Known for its compact design and powerful performance, it excels in mid-range combat and offers considerable customization via the Gunsmith system.
In Black Ops 6: Zombies, the CR-56 AMAX delivers high-damage hits with a fast fire rate and good handling, allowing players to eliminate enemies in three to four shots up to 25 meters, even against armored targets. However, its mid-range focus and potential limitations in ammo capacity or specialized zombie encounters may prompt players to seek alternatives that offer enhanced crowd control, sustained fire, or unique tactical advantages.

Alternative #1: AS VAL
The AS VAL stands out as a strong alternative to the CR-56 AMAX, particularly for players who prioritize stealth and rapid target elimination. While the CR-56 AMAX excels in mid-range engagements with its balanced damage and handling, the AS VAL offers superior close-quarters performance with its high fire rate and integrated suppressor, making it ideal for silent takedowns.
Statistically, the AS VAL boasts a faster time-to-kill (TTK) at close ranges, compensating for its lower damage per bullet with a blistering fire rate. This allows players to quickly dispatch zombies before they can react, especially in confined spaces. A recommended loadout for the AS VAL includes attachments that enhance its recoil control and magazine capacity to mitigate its inherent drawbacks. Specific gameplay scenarios where the AS VAL shines include clearing tight corridors and silently eliminating high-value targets without alerting nearby zombies, providing a tactical edge over the more conspicuous CR-56 AMAX.
Alternative #2: GPMG-7
The GPMG-7 serves as a robust alternative to the CR-56 AMAX, especially for players who favor sustained firepower and area denial. While the CR-56 AMAX is effective in mid-range engagements, the GPMG-7 excels in providing continuous fire support with its large magazine capacity and high bullet penetration, making it ideal for mowing down hordes of zombies.
Statistically, the GPMG-7 offers a higher damage per mag and superior suppression capabilities compared to the CR-56 AMAX, allowing players to control larger areas and keep the undead at bay. A recommended loadout for the GPMG-7 includes attachments that improve its recoil control and mobility to compensate for its heavier handling. Specific gameplay scenarios where the GPMG-7 shines include defending strategic positions, clearing out large groups of zombies, and providing covering fire for teammates, offering a tactical advantage over the more mobile but less sustained CR-56 AMAX.
Alternative #3: ASG-89
The ASG-89 offers a unique alternative to the CR-56 AMAX, catering to players who prefer aggressive, close-quarters combat. While the CR-56 AMAX is versatile at mid-range, the ASG-89 delivers devastating damage in tight spaces, making it ideal for clearing rooms and dispatching tightly packed zombies.
Statistically, the ASG-89 boasts unparalleled burst damage at close range, allowing players to eliminate multiple zombies with a single shot. However, its limited range and slower reload times require a more tactical approach. A recommended loadout for the ASG-89 includes attachments that enhance its reload speed and pellet spread to maximize its effectiveness. Specific gameplay scenarios where the ASG-89 excels include clearing out confined areas, defending chokepoints, and quickly eliminating high-threat zombies, providing a high-risk, high-reward alternative to the more balanced CR-56 AMAX.
